终极Windows 11精简指南:使用tiny11builder快速创建纯净系统镜像
终极Windows 11精简指南:使用tiny11builder快速创建纯净系统镜像
【免费下载链接】tiny11builderScripts to build a trimmed-down Windows 11 image.项目地址: https://gitcode.com/GitHub_Trending/ti/tiny11builder
你是否厌倦了Windows 11系统自带的20多款预装应用?是否觉得系统启动缓慢、磁盘空间被无谓占用?今天,我将为你介绍一个革命性的解决方案——tiny11builder,这是一个完全用PowerShell编写的自动化脚本工具,能够将Windows 11系统镜像精简40-50%,让你的电脑运行速度提升30%以上!
为什么选择tiny11builder?🚀
现代Windows 11系统安装后占用25-30GB磁盘空间,其中大量组件对普通用户来说完全是冗余的。tiny11builder通过智能化的组件筛选机制,帮助你获得一个纯净、高效的Windows 11系统:
- 释放宝贵存储空间:系统镜像从标准5.5GB缩减至3.2GB
- 提升系统性能:移除不必要的后台服务,内存使用率显著降低
- 加速启动过程:启动时间缩短40%,应用程序响应更迅速
- 获得纯净体验:告别强制预装应用,完全掌控你的系统环境
两种精简模式:标准版 vs 核心版
tiny11builder提供了两种不同级别的精简方案,满足不同用户需求:
标准精简模式 (tiny11maker.ps1) ✅
- 移除20多种预装应用和游戏
- 保持系统可维护性和更新能力
- 支持后续添加语言包和功能组件
- 适合日常办公和家庭使用
核心精简模式 (tiny11coremaker.ps1) ⚡
- 深度精简系统组件,包括Windows组件存储
- 移除Windows Defender和更新功能
- 生成最小化的系统镜像
- 专为测试环境和虚拟机设计
重要提示:核心模式生成的是不可维护的系统镜像,无法添加更新、语言包或功能组件,仅推荐用于临时测试环境。
准备工作:三分钟环境配置
在开始精简之旅前,你需要准备以下资源:
- Windows 11官方镜像:从Microsoft官网下载最新版本
- PowerShell 5.1或更高版本:确保管理员权限运行
- 充足磁盘空间:建议预留10GB以上空闲空间
- tiny11builder项目文件:通过以下命令获取完整脚本
git clone https://gitcode.com/GitHub_Trending/ti/tiny11builder四步完成系统精简
第一步:权限配置与脚本准备
以管理员身份打开PowerShell,进入项目目录并设置执行策略:
cd tiny11builder Set-ExecutionPolicy Bypass -Scope Process第二步:挂载镜像并执行精简
假设你的Windows 11 ISO挂载在E盘,工作目录设为D盘,运行以下命令:
.\tiny11maker.ps1 -ISO E -SCRATCH D第三步:选择系统版本
脚本运行后,你会看到可选的Windows SKU列表。根据你的需求选择相应版本,推荐"Windows 11 Pro"以获得完整功能支持。
第四步:自动化处理与等待
脚本将自动执行以下流程:
- 解析原始系统镜像文件结构
- 智能识别并移除指定预装应用
- 应用系统优化配置和注册表调整
- 使用DISM工具进行压缩处理
- 生成最终的tiny11.iso精简镜像
整个过程大约需要15-30分钟,具体时间取决于你的硬件配置。
精简效果对比:数据说话
存储空间优化
- 镜像文件大小:从5.5GB降至3.2GB(减少41.8%)
- 安装后磁盘占用:从25-30GB降至12-18GB(减少40-50%)
性能提升指标
- 系统启动时间:缩短40%
- 后台进程数量:从150+个减少至85-110个
- 预装应用数量:移除20+款非必要应用
应用移除清单
- 娱乐应用:Xbox、Solitaire、Media Player
- 微软全家桶:Edge浏览器、OneDrive、Office Hub
- 系统工具:Feedback Hub、QuickAssist、Internet Explorer
- 预装应用:News、Weather、Maps、Alarms等
技术原理:智能精简策略
tiny11builder的精简过程基于多层筛选机制:
- 应用层清理:通过PowerShell脚本自动移除娱乐、新闻、天气等非必要应用
- 服务层优化:禁用或移除低优先级系统服务
- 组件层筛选:保留核心功能,移除冗余组件
- 配置层调整:优化系统设置提升性能
脚本内置的autounattend.xml文件实现了自动化安装配置,包括跳过微软账户验证、启用压缩部署等优化设置。
实际应用场景解析
开发测试环境搭建
对于软件开发者来说,tiny11builder是构建标准化测试环境的理想工具:
- 虚拟机模板创建:生成轻量级系统镜像,快速部署测试环境
- CI/CD流水线集成:确保每次测试都在相同的纯净环境中进行
- 性能基准测试:消除预装应用对测试结果的干扰
老旧硬件性能提升
如果你的电脑配置较低,运行完整版Windows 11会感到卡顿,精简版系统能显著改善使用体验:
- 内存占用减少:从4GB内存需求降至2.5GB
- CPU负载降低:后台服务减少,系统响应更灵敏
- 存储空间释放:为重要文件和应用腾出更多空间
企业批量部署
IT管理员可以使用tiny11builder创建定制化系统镜像:
- 统一办公环境:移除与工作无关的应用
- 安全加固:减少攻击面,提升系统安全性
- 部署效率提升:镜像体积小,网络传输和安装更快
进阶技巧:自定义精简配置
如果你需要更精细的控制,可以编辑脚本文件来自定义精简规则。在tiny11maker.ps1中,你可以找到应用移除列表:
# 查看要移除的应用列表 Get-Content tiny11maker.ps1 | Select-String "Remove-AppxPackage"你还可以修改以下配置:
- 添加保留的应用:注释掉对应的移除命令
- 调整系统设置:修改注册表配置部分
- 自定义安装流程:编辑autounattend.xml文件
常见问题与解决方案
问题:脚本执行权限错误
解决方案:
# 以管理员身份运行PowerShell # 然后执行以下命令 Set-ExecutionPolicy RemoteSigned -Scope CurrentUser问题:镜像构建失败
检查清单:
- 确保有足够的磁盘空间(至少10GB)
- 验证Windows 11 ISO文件完整性
- 确认挂载的驱动器字母正确
- 检查PowerShell版本是否为5.1或更高
问题:精简后功能缺失
应对策略:
- 如果使用标准版,可以通过Windows功能添加恢复
- 核心版无法恢复功能,建议重新制作标准版镜像
- 重要功能缺失时,考虑保留原版系统
问题:arm64架构错误提示
说明:这是正常现象,因为arm64版本的Windows 11镜像中不包含OneDriveSetup.exe文件,脚本会跳过相关操作,不影响最终结果。
注意事项与最佳实践
版本兼容性指南
- 支持所有Windows 11版本:包括家庭版、专业版、企业版
- 架构兼容:x64和arm64架构均可使用
- 建议环境:在相同架构的主机上运行脚本
- 备份重要数据:精简前确保重要文件已备份
长期使用建议
- 选择标准版:除非特殊需求,否则推荐使用标准精简版
- 定期更新:关注项目更新,获取最新优化
- 测试验证:在新环境中充分测试后再部署到生产环境
- 文档记录:记录自定义配置,便于后续维护
性能优化技巧
- SSD存储:在固态硬盘上运行脚本和安装系统
- 充足内存:确保有8GB以上内存以获得最佳体验
- 网络连接:下载最新Windows 11镜像确保兼容性
- 杀毒软件:临时禁用杀毒软件避免干扰脚本运行
开始你的系统精简之旅
现在你已经掌握了使用tiny11builder创建精简Windows 11系统的完整知识。无论你是追求极致性能的开发者,还是希望延长老旧设备寿命的用户,这个工具都能帮助你实现目标。
记住,系统精简不是简单的删除文件,而是基于对系统架构的深入理解进行的智能优化。tiny11builder通过科学的组件分析和依赖关系处理,确保精简后的系统既轻量又稳定。
立即行动:下载项目代码,按照指南操作,亲身体验精简系统带来的性能提升。如果在使用过程中遇到任何问题,可以参考项目文档或寻求社区帮助。
精简系统,释放潜能,让每一份硬件资源都发挥最大价值!
【免费下载链接】tiny11builderScripts to build a trimmed-down Windows 11 image.项目地址: https://gitcode.com/GitHub_Trending/ti/tiny11builder
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考
